About the role
- Makes business decisions regarding new business that includes closely-held (non-publicly traded) assets and evaluates ability to accept these assets.
- Involved in more complex sales of assets and related legal issues.
- Monitors, coordinates, interprets and processes financial and non-financial information on a monthly basis relating to closely-held (non-publicly traded) assets held within Investment Management and Trust accounts.
- May provide guidance to other team members.
- Works with the sales and fiduciary teams who are proposing new business that includes a closely-held asset.
- Evaluates ability to accept the asset and helps determine the best plan of administration.
- Coordinates and operates committee presentations with advisors and other committee chairs responsible for the oversight of special asset acceptance, administration or disposition reviews.
- Works with various internal partners to help support the acquisition, accurate reporting and sale of assigned closely-held assets and is often the lead for these relationships.
- Coordinates and conducts fiduciary reviews of assigned closely-held business assets, including more complex assets or relationships, held within wealth accounts and makes investment/fiduciary recommendations related to the asset for presentation at the monthly committee meeting.
- Provides compliance-based reporting for assets that have been flagged as exceptions as well as oversees, coordinates and performs compliance reviews for assets accepted.
